Activists from several immigrant rights and social justice groups gathered in Washington DC on Tuesday, marking a ‘Day Without Immigrants,’ to demand immigration reform.
During this national day of action, immigrants are encouraged not to work or make purchases to raise awareness about their impact and contribution to the American economy and society.
“We won’t ever stop the fight until we gain a path to citizenship,” said one of the activists speaking during the protest.
The crowd, chanting slogans and holding banners, could be seen rallying outside the White House.

SOT, Protester: “We are tired of you playing games with our lives but not fulfilling your promises. The immigrant movement has been fighting for a path to citizenship for more than 30 years, and even though we have had some victories, like DACA and TPS, we won’t ever stop the fight until we gain a path to citizenship. In the most recent years, we felt power in the 2020 elections, when immigrants’ vote made it possible for the Democrats to win battleground states like New York, Arizona, Georgia, Pennsylvania, among others. This made it possible for Democrats to have a majority in the Senate, and for Biden to win the presidency.”
